2. DId you update it from the patch page?
Those two usually cure this issue, but also check
3. Did you update your graphics and sound drivers?
If so...
Find nwnplayer.ini and set safemovie to "1"...
If there is still aproblem, post details of your machine and expecially which graphics card, in a new thread in this forum, and the tech guys will help you.

Shia Luck wrote...
There aretwo[/u]now 3 main ways to put NWN onto a windows 7 machine.
If you wish to install from the disk(s) or from GOG
1. Install game using a custom install. When you are given the path to the install folder, change the path using the browse folder button so that it is not installed in 'programs (x86)', but directly on C drive. Do not make any shortcuts during the install process.
2. ([u]Diamond edition disc only) Run the patch on the disk.
Update: I looked through the disc directory again, and saw the 1.66 update on my Diamond disc, so I have run that.
4. Open NWN folder and find nwnmain.exe and nwn.exe.
5. Right click on these and select properties. Set them to run with full permissions, as administrator and under compatibility mode windows XP service pack 3.
